Transaction 63ca840110cf856810a247d6c134382ae3b4a17a18dda0640b82a41373c4f713

1 Input
2 Outputs
  • 63ca840110cf856810a247d6c134382ae3b4a17a18dda0640b82a41373c4f713:0
  • value  53742
    address  3NB19pSeQJX6uWjTVf1haWxX72GurXtc3a
  • 63ca840110cf856810a247d6c134382ae3b4a17a18dda0640b82a41373c4f713:1
  • value  99800000
    address  1ECBYhdSmA8ez3MDNQvhK4dnEvozQAxcMg